AIZ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

346 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Assurant (AIZ)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$4.83B — down 3.4% from $5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 52 funds opened new AIZ positions and 45 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 100 added to existing stakes and 156 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of New York Mellon, adding an estimated $50.9M. The largest seller was Westfield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$87.1M sold.
